| Category | Tokyo | Wakayama |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Other | ¥254,650 | ¥207,120 | -18.7% |
| Food & Groceries | ¥76,097 | ¥65,648 | -13.7% |
| Entertainment | ¥24,897 | ¥16,460 | -33.9% |
| Transportation | ¥19,729 | ¥15,122 | -23.3% |
| Housing & Rent | ¥19,262 | ¥16,078 | -16.5% |
| Healthcare | ¥11,321 | ¥8,450 | -25.4% |
| Utilities | ¥10,419 | ¥10,595 | +1.7% |
| Clothing | ¥9,285 | ¥5,710 | -38.5% |
| Education | ¥5,111 | ¥2,600 | -49.1% |
| Total (Monthly) | ¥430,771 | ¥347,782 | -19.3% |
Tokyo is approximately 19% more expensive than Wakayama based on official government statistics.
The estimated monthly cost of living in Tokyo for a single person is approximately ¥430,771 (~$2,872 USD).
The estimated monthly cost of living in Wakayama for a single person is approximately ¥347,782 (~$2,319 USD).
